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Expression '2 power 2 multiplied by 2 power 3 over 2 power 4'.

To find : What is the simplified expression ?

Solution :

Writing expression in numeric form,

'2 power 2 multiplied by 2 power 3 over 2 power 4',

i.e. [tex]\frac{2^2\times 2^3}{2^4}[/tex]

Solving the expression,

As, [tex]x^a\times x^b=x^{a+b}[/tex]

[tex]\frac{2^2\times 2^3}{2^4}=\frac{2^{2+3}}{2^4}[/tex]

[tex]\frac{2^2\times 2^3}{2^4}=\frac{2^{5}}{2^4}[/tex]

As, [tex]\farc{x^a}{x^b}=x^{a-b}[/tex]

[tex]\frac{2^2\times 2^3}{2^4}=2^{5-4}[/tex]

[tex]\frac{2^2\times 2^3}{2^4}=2^{1}[/tex]
